The Landlady Listens In this episode of The Landlady Listens, host Meg Hayden sits down with second-generation mortgage broker Alex Wallace from Cornerstone Commercial Capital. Alex breaks down the nuances of commercial lending, pulling back the curtain on everything from Small Business Administration (SBA) loans to private lending solutions. Whether you are a business owner looking to transition from a food truck to a brick-and-mortar space, or an investor looking into new construction and rehab projects, this episode offers a roadmap for your financial journey. Alex shares the "three keys" every strong borrower needs—experience, credit, and liquidity—and discusses how he balances modern digital files with a traditional pen-and-paper approach to deeply connect with his clients' files. Tune in to learn how to stop paying rent, leverage your commercial real estate, and nurture your business goals just like a summer garden. * Host: Meg Hayden * Guest: Alex Wallace

Episode 33: Real Estate Financing Strategies with TJ Curran

Real estate investing isn’t just about finding deals, it’s about knowing how to finance them. In this episode of The Landlady Listens, TJ Curran of Go Rascal joins us for a deep dive into today’s lending landscape, from traditional mortgages to non QM products, DSCR loans, and condo hotel financing. With over 20 years in the mortgage industry and now working as a broker with access to multiple lending channels, TJ breaks down how investors are getting deals done that most lenders won’t touch. We also talk through condo hotels, Airbnb and short term rental financing, and how DSCR loans allow investors to qualify based on rental income instead of personal income. TJ shares insights on risk based lending, condo approval challenges, and why having access to multiple funding sources can completely change what’s possible in a deal. Episode 30: From Survival to Stability with Vanessa Volz

What happens when a domestic violence shelter decides to become a housing developer? In this powerful episode of The Landlady Listens, Vanessa Volz, President and CEO of Sojourner House, shares how her organization evolved from crisis intervention into creating long-term housing solutions for survivors of domestic violence, sexual assault, and human trafficking. Vanessa opens up about the realities survivors face when trying to leave abusive situations, why housing is one of the biggest barriers to safety, and how Sojourner House built a portfolio of over 40 apartments to help families rebuild their lives with stability and dignity. This conversation goes beyond real estate.
